1. A vehicle collision avoidance system comprising:

  • a circumferentially rotating pulsed infrared laser beam scanner apparatus including a laser pulsed emitter and an infrared laser sensor for generating a first signal representative of an obstacle scanned, the laser pulsed emitter rotating circumferentially in a horizontal plane and a vertical plane simultaneously, the infrared laser sensor circumferentially rotating synchronously with the laser pulsed emitter in the horizontal plane and receiving a reflected laser beam signal from the obstacle scanned;

    wherein the laser pulsed emitter is emitting a laser beam signal over a 360°

    field of view and the infrared laser sensor is receiving the reflected laser beam signal over the 360°

    field of view;

    a processing circuit coupled to the circumferentially rotating pulsed infrared laser beam scanner apparatus for processing the first signal and generating a plurality of signals;

    a processor coupled to the processing circuit for processing the plurality of signals and generating a braking signal; and

    a braking apparatus responsive to the braking signal.
